In-Depth Analysis
iPhotron
macOS Photos-style photo manager for Windows with folder-native, non-destructive editing and Live Photo support.
Strengths
- +Completely free and open source under MIT license
- +Non-destructive editing preserves all original files
- +Cross-platform with installers for Windows, Linux, and macOS
- +Live Photo support brings an Apple ecosystem feature to Windows
- +Rich editing tools rival paid photo managers
Weaknesses
- -Requires Python 3.10+ and external tools (ExifTool, FFmpeg)
- -iphotron.com website is currently unreachable
- -Relatively new project with limited community documentation
- -No built-in cloud sync or backup functionality
- -Performance with very large libraries (100K+ photos) is untested
